I agree that its better to have a custom Netflix look rather than the same Netflix UI. e.g. Xbox, PS3, WMC all ahve a different NEtflix interface and they look great and IMO more usable than the standard one.
Most devices are limited in the amount of data they can process and thus the standard UI only shows one movie at a time. PC's (and consoles) are a lot more powerful. In fact I think the best way would be to make a 'Netflix movie provider' as a video source, and it would integrate into standard movie views. I don't know if that's possible using XBMC architecture.
